Express heartfelt condolences with REMEMBRANCE, a serene sympathy bouquet handcrafted by Florist South Woodford. This elegant arrangement features pure white roses, striking blue sprayed roses, delicate freesia and airy gypsophila, all nestled in fresh, lush greenery. Designed to offer comfort and support at difficult times, REMEMBRANCE is ideal for funerals, memorials or sending sympathy flowers to the family home.

Each bouquet is carefully prepared by our skilled florists in South Woodford and delivered in bud to ensure up to 5 days of freshness, allowing the flowers to open beautifully in front of your eyes. We use premium stems and tasteful colours to create a respectful and refined tribute that reflects your thoughts and feelings.

Next day flower delivery is available across South Woodford and surrounding areas on orders placed before 4pm. In the rare event that a particular bloom is out of season, we follow a thoughtful substitution policy, choosing flowers of similar colour, size and value to maintain the same elegant style.
